Abhishek Sharma has praised Shubman Gill for becoming India’s new Test captain. The two cricketers have known each other since their early days in Punjab cricket and share a deep friendship. Gill, just 25, is now set to lead India in Tests, taking over from Rohit Sharma ahead of the England series. In a chat with Star Sports, Abhishek shared how proud he is of Gill’s achievement. He recalled their journey together from playing U-14 and U-16 cricket for Punjab to now seeing Gill take on such a major responsibility. Abhishek said, “I think if I see his career, you know, if I remember the old days when we were just starting playing for the U-14 and U-16 Punjab team. As youngsters, we all started with the red ball. He praised his friend’s skill and mindset, calling him one of the best talents the country has produced across formats. He added, “Humne junior cricket saath dekha tha (We’ve watched and played junior cricket together). He is one of the best players India has produced in all three formats, and wo acha isko nibhayega bhi (he will play his role to perfection). I believe he will do really well for Team India and as a captain as well.” Gill is now India’s fifth-youngest Test captain and the 37th overall. His calm approach and solid technique have earned praise from many experts and now, with the captaincy in hand, he has a new challenge to conquer. Before leading India, Gill’s immediate focus will be on the IPL, where he will try to guide Gujarat Titans to their second title as they take on Mumbai Indians in the Eliminator on May 30.
